Paresh Rawal Confirms Hera Pheri 3 Shoot in Feb, Says ‘Ghaav Bhar Gaya Hai’

Paresh Rawal confirms that he will begin shooting for Hera Pheri 3 in February-March 2026. The veteran actor says the past controversy over his exit is behind him and that his bond with Priyadarshan is now 'stronger and sharper.'

Paresh Rawal Opens Up on Hera Pheri 3

Paresh Rawal has officially confirmed that Hera Pheri 3 will go on floors in February-March 2026. Speaking in an exclusive interview, the veteran actor revealed that the much-loved comedy franchise is back on track, with him reuniting with Akshay Kumar and Suniel Shetty.

Past Controversy Resolved on Hera Pheri 3

Earlier this year, Rawal shocked fans when he announced his exit from the Priyadarshan directorial, despite Akshay Kumar buying rights to the film. The move allegedly caused financial hurdles for the project and even led Akshay to consider legal action. However, Rawal clarified that he stepped back due to genuine reasons and returned the signing amount with interest.

Stronger Bond With Priyadarshan

While many speculated that the controversy could impact his rapport with Priyadarshan, Rawal insists otherwise. “A lot has happened but that hasn’t soured my relationship with Priyadarshan. In fact, it has made our bond sharper and stronger. Ghaav bhar gaya hai. Our relationship is very transparent,” Rawal said. The actor recently wrapped Priyadarshan’s comeback film Bhoot Bangla.

The Baburao Spin-Off Question

Fans have long hoped for a Baburao Ganpatrao Apte spin-off, but Rawal isn’t convinced. “We haven’t discussed a spin-off on Baburao. A film is a collaborative effort. I don’t think Baburao can exist alone. Shyam and Raju are equally important,” he explained. He further added, “I’m not a greedy actor. Even if a standalone film happens, Shyam and Raju also need to be there.”

Reflections on Phir Hera Pheri

Rawal also opened up about his dissatisfaction with Phir Hera Pheri. “They became over-confident while making it. Characters like those in Hera Pheri are rare, and they must be handled with care. While dubbing, I realised we had made a mistake. It robbed the film of its sanctity,” he admitted. However, he praised Suniel Shetty for staying true to his character throughout the sequel.
